Output 81d87aefc62bc256758a40b1f8e950594169955d612a9fa290ba3228415eca9f:1

value
59300364
script pubkey
OP_0 OP_PUSHBYTES_32 8ddc31862e0854441069beb9bf569272f2c818bbea9bf9c6d59e197f57a71246
address
bc1q3hwrrp3wpp2ygyrfh6um745jwtevsx9ma2dln3k4ncvh74a8zfrqz2h0yx
transaction
81d87aefc62bc256758a40b1f8e950594169955d612a9fa290ba3228415eca9f
spent
true